Aaron Judge reaches 40 home runs and 100 RBI this season

Aaron Judge is going to have the best campaign of his career in the 2024 season of the Major Leagues. The New York Yankees catcher connected the home run number 40 of the year in the first inning of the game against the Toronto Blue Jays and thanks to Juan Soto who was on the way, he came to 101 runs produced.

The umpire found Kevin Gausman’s snake, a fastball that traveled 95.3 miles per hour, and sent it to deep center field. Depending on the service Statistics, The ball traveled 477 mph at 117.5 mph.

With that, ‘El Juez’ was the first player to reach these numbers in the 2024 season. In terms of home runs, the closest pursuit is Shohei Ohtani with 32 homers. Among the runs produced, José Ramírez, an infielder for the Cleveland Guardians, is on track with 91 RBIs.

Compared to career-best numbers, the Yankees outfielder is aiming to surpass them this year. In 2022 set the AL home run record with 61 and reached 131 RBI. The possibility of setting new personal records is very good because the Yankees have 50 games left..

Births for Babe Ruth, Lou Gehrig and Mickey Mantle

By hitting 40 home runs this season, Judge joined a select group of players in Yankees history. Few baseball players have hit 40 or more HR in three different seasons in Bronx Bombers history and ’99 joined a group consisting of Babe Ruth, Lou Gehrig and Mickey Mantle.
